Consort marks Women’s History Month
Visual artist Nori Green joins the
Hutchins Consort to unveil a new portrait of Carleen Hutchins,
the namesake of the Hutchins Consort. The consort performs on
an octet of harmonically matched and scaled string instruments
designed and crafted by Hutchins, an American luthier and
acoustician.
